Corona virus: Latest updates on Covid-19 crisis in India

Here are the latest updates on the corona virus crisis in on Saturday.

  • Union Minister Nitin Gadkari asks NHAI chief and toll operators across national highways to ensure provision of food and water support to migrant workers.
  • UP government arranges 1,000 buses for stranded migrant workers to get back home.
  • The Indian railways manufactures prototype of isolation ward in non-AC train coaches.
  • Delhi Deputy CM Manish Sisodia says the city government has started distributing ration for the next month in the wake of the 21-day lockdown.
  • Maharashtra minister Amit Deshmukh says the state will create special facilities for the treatment of coronavirus.
  • Centre tells states and UTs to take action in maintaining hygiene in jails and in handling prisoners.
  • Mother Dairy doubles supply of fruits and vegetables to over 300 tons a day in Delhi-NCR amid lockdown.
  • Hyundai Motor’s CSR arm says it is ordering advanced testing kits for coronavirus from Korea.
  • The government says it is working to ensure critical coal supplies during the lockdown.
  • Restrictions continue in Kashmir as police book several people for organizing Friday prayers.
  • Forty-five people are detained in Manipur for violating lockdown orders.
  • Door-to-door delivery of essentials in Himachal Pradesh’s Hamirpur town will extent to other urban and municipal areas of the district, official says.
